  6. 15 hours ago, Dunchues said:

     

    It's not the scooter so much as the type. If you rent one of the standard smallish 4 wheel ones they are usually too heavy for the tender crew to load and too large for the coach. If you buy one buy a folding type as light as possible, similarly if you rent. They are not inexpensive but will allow you to go just about anywhere, even folding into a taxi trunk. I have a Travelscoot that is very lightweight,  and an Atto which is a bit heavier but breaks into 2 parts to fit a planes overhead locker. They are not inexpensive but will make a dramatic difference to your enjoyment of the trip.

    We too own a couple of Travelscoot's.  Very lightweight and easy to travel with.

Boy what a glitchy system.  Platinum and paid in full.  Sailing on Regal Princess.  At first would only allow Allegro to be booked.  Can't do that because of disability and can't get to that aft dining.  Then finally figured out to go to the Reserve Dining and not the calendar to book it.  Selected Concerto for the days I wanted and saved each.  Went back to calendar to check and not there.  Closed app and checked again.  Only Symphony available.  Selected Symphony and it only shows 5:00 (early) and 7:30 (late).  I guess Symphony is all traditional dining.  Clicked 7:30 for each and all set.
